Valence Electrons

Valence electrons are the outermost electrons of an atom and are crucial in determining how an element reacts chemically. They are involved in forming bonds with other atoms. The number of valence electrons can be inferred from the element's position in the periodic table, particularly for main group elements.

Ion Formation

Ions are charged particles that form when atoms gain or lose electrons. A 3+ ion indicates that the element has lost three electrons, resulting in a positive charge. Understanding how ions form is essential for predicting the behavior of elements in chemical reactions and their stability.

Orbital Diagrams

Orbital diagrams visually represent the distribution of electrons in an atom's orbitals. Each box in the diagram corresponds to an orbital, and arrows indicate the presence of electrons. Analyzing these diagrams helps identify the electron configuration of an element, which is key to determining its identity and properties.
